IMPORTANT SAFETY INSTRUCTIONS

PLEASE READ CAREFULLY BEFORE USE • FOR HOUSEHOLD USE ONLY

Read and review instructions for operation and use.

Indicates the presence of a hazard that can cause personal injury,
death or substantial property damage if the warning included with this
symbol is ignored.

For indoor and household use only.

When using electrical appliances, basic safety precautions should always be
followed, including the following:

To reduce the risk of electric shock, this appliance has a polarized plug
(one blade is wider than the other). This plug will fit into a polarized outlet only one
way. If the plug does not fit fully into the outlet, reverse the plug.
If it still does not fit, contact a qualified electrician to install the proper outlet.
DO NOT modify the plug in any way. Extension cords are not recommended for use with
this product.

WARNING

1 DO NOT try to place the blade onto
the power pod and then into the Jar.
ALWAYS assemble the blade inside the
jar.

2 Remove utensils prior to processing.
Failure to remove may cause the jar to
be damaged or to shatter which may
cause personal injury.

3 The blades are sharp, not locked in
place, and removable. Handle with care.
When handling the blades, always hold
them by the shaft. Failure to do so will
result in a risk of laceration.

4 Make sure to carefully remove the splash
guard lid and blade assembly, holding it
by the shaft, before emptying contents
of the jar. Failure to do so will result in a
risk of laceration.

5 DO NOT place ingredients into the
jar without first installing the blade
assembly.

6 DO NOT operate the appliance without
the splash guard lid in place.

7 DO NOT blend hot liquids, as doing so
may cause excessive pressure buildup,
resulting in a risk of the user being
burned.

8 To protect against electrical shock,
DO NOT submerge the appliance or
allow the power cord to come into
contact with water or any other liquid.

9 DO NOT allow the appliance to be
used by children. Close supervision is
necessary when used near children. This
is not a toy.

10 NEVER leave an appliance unattended
when in use.

11 Appliance accessories are not intended
to be used in the microwave, as it may
result in damage to the accessories.

12 Remove the power pod from the
appliance and unplug the power cord
from the electrical outlet when not in
use, before assembling or disassembling
parts, and before cleaning. To unplug,
grasp the plug and pull from the
electrical outlet. NEVER pull from the
power cord.

13 DO NOT abuse the power cord. NEVER
carry the power pod by the power cord
or yank it to disconnect from electrical
outlet; instead grasp the plug and pull
to disconnect.

14 DO NOT operate any appliance with
a damaged cord or plug or after the
appliance malfunctions or has been
dropped or damaged in any manner.
This appliance has no serviceable parts.
Return the appliance to SharkNinja
Operating LLC for examination, repair, or
adjustment.

15 DO NOT let the power cord hang over
the edges of tables or counters or touch
hot surfaces such as the stove.

16 ALWAYS use appliance on a clean, dry,
level surface.

17 Keep hands, hair, clothing, and utensils
out of container while processing to
reduce the risk of severe injury to
persons or damage to the appliance. A
scraper may be used, but only when the
appliance is not running.

18 Avoid contact with moving parts.

19 DO NOT attempt to sharpen blades.

20 DO NOT use the appliance if blades are
bent or damaged.

21 DO NOT expose jar to extreme
temperature changes.

22 DO NOT use jar if cracked or chipped.

23 DO NOT operate the appliance on or
near any hot surfaces (such as on a gas
or electric burner or in a heated oven).

24 The use of accessory attachments,
including canning jars, is not
recommended by the manufacturer and
may cause fire, electrical shock, or risk of
personal injury.

25 DO NOT remove the power pod before
the blades have stopped turning.

26 DO NOT overfill.

27 DO NOT operate the appliance empty.

28 DO NOT try to defeat the interlock
mechanism. Make sure the blades
are properly installed before operating
the appliance.

29 Immediately release the Power Pod
control button on the power pod if the
appliance malfunctions during use.

30 DO NOT operate the appliance for more
than 60 seconds continuously. When
using the dough blade, DO NOT operate
the appliance for more than 30 seconds
continuously.

31 If the appliance overheats, a thermal
switch will activate and shut off the
motor. To reset, unplug the appliance
and let it cool down for approximately 10
minutes before using again.

32 This product is intended for household
use only. DO NOT use this appliance for
anything other than its intended use.
DO NOT use outdoors.

33 When using the dough blade, max fill 1 L.

34 Chopped meat cannot ever exceed
250 g in 0.5 inch cubes. Operating time
should be no more than 15 continuous
seconds.

BEFORE FIRST USE

IMPORTANT: Review all warnings on
pages 4–7 before proceeding.

NOTE: Be careful not to over-process.
Use repeated short pulses until your
desired consistency is reached.

  1. Remove all packaging material and labels
    from the appliance. Separate all parts.

  2. Wash the jar, splash guard lid, and blades
    in warm, soapy water. When washing
    the blades, use a dishwashing utensil with
    a handle to avoid direct hand contact
    with blades.

  3. Handle the blades with care to avoid
    contact with sharp edges. Rinse and
    air-dry thoroughly.

  4. The jar, splash guard lid, and blades are all
    dishwasher safe. It is recommended that
    the jar, splash guard lid, and blades be
    placed on the top rack. Ensure blades are
    removed from the jar before placing in
    the dishwasher.

  5. Wipe the Power Pod clean with a
    damp cloth.

ASSEMBLING & USING THE JAR

IMPORTANT: Review all warnings on
pages 4–7 before proceeding.

1 Place the jar on a clean, dry, level surface.
2 Holding the blade by the shaft, carefully
lower it onto the spindle pin inside the jar

3 Add the ingredients to be processed into the jar.
4 Place splash guard lid on the jar.

5 Place the power pod on top of the
splash guard lid, making sure it is
securely in place.

6 To start the appliance, plug the power
cord into an electrical outlet, securely
hold the power pod, and press the Power
Pod control button located on the top of
the power pod. Continue to hold jar and
power pod firmly while operating.

7 To stop the appliance, stop pressing the
Power Pod control button.
8 Make sure the blade has stopped
completely before removing the power pod.

9 If ingredients stick to the sides of the jar,
stop the appliance, remove the power
pod and splash guard lid, then use a
spatula to scrape ingredients down
toward the blades.

10 To remove ingredients with a thinner
consistency, pour them through the spout
on the splash guard lid. To remove
contents with thicker consistencies, first
take off the splash guard lid. Carefully
remove the blade and set it aside before
emptying contents from jar.

CARE & MAINTENANCE

CLEANING
1 Separate all parts.

2 Hand-Washing: Wash the jar, splash
guard lid, and blades in warm, soapy
water. When washing the blades, use
a dishwashing utensil with a handle to
avoid direct hand contact with blades.
Handle the blades with care to avoid
contact with sharp edges. Rinse and
air-dry thoroughly.

Dishwasher: The jar, splash guard lid,
and blades are all dishwasher safe. It is
recommended that the blades be placed
on the top rack. Ensure the blades are
removed from the jar before placing in
the dishwasher.

3 Wipe the Power Pod clean with a
damp cloth.

USING THE POWER POD CLEANING BRUSH

  1. Use the bristled end of the power pod
    cleaning brush to gently remove any
    debris from the base of the power pod.

  2. Carefully use the pointed end of the
    power pod cleaning brush to remove
    stuck-on debris.

  3. Gently rinse the power pod cleaning
    brush after use and let air-dry.

NOTE: DO NOT use the power pod
cleaning brush to clean any part of the
Ninja® Ultra Prep®, except for the base
of the power pod.

STORING

  1. Store the unit upright with the Total
    Crushing® & Power Chopping Blade inside the
    jar. Place the splash guard lid on top of the jar,
    and the power pod on top of the splash guard
    lid. Store the High-Speed Blade inside the
    storage box, and the dough blade in a drawer.

RESETTING THE MOTOR THERMOSTAT

The unit features a unique safety system
that prevents damage to the unit’s motor
and drive system should you inadvertently
overload it. If the appliance is overloaded,
the motor will stop. To reset the appliance,
follow the resetting procedure below:

  1. Unplug the appliance from the
    electrical outlet.

  2. Remove the power pod and splash guard
    lid and empty the container to ensure no
    ingredients are jamming the blade assembly.

  3. Allow the appliance to cool for
    approximately 10 minutes.

  4. Replace the splash guard lid and power
    pod and plug the appliance into the
    electrical outlet.

  5. Proceed to use the appliance as
    before, making sure not to exceed the
    recommended maximum capacities.

HELPFUL TIPS

  • For coarse chopping, use short, quick
    pulses and monitor food texture.

  • For mincing, chopping, and pureeing,
    increase the length of pulses.

  • To crush ice into snow, start by using
    short pulses to break up large pieces,
    then continue processing until snow
    is achieved.

  • The Total Crushing® & Power Chopping
    Blade can be used to chop meat, fish,
    vegetables, and more.

  • For finer purees, dressings, and
    extractions, use the High-Speed Blade.

  • Cut larger ingredients into smaller pieces
    to better fit them in the Ninja® Ultra Prep®.
    When chopping harder foods like meat,
    cut them into 1-inch cubes.

TROUBLESHOOTING GUIDE

WARNING: To reduce the risk of shock and unintended operation,
turn power off and unplug unit before troubleshooting.

Motor does not start or blade assembly does not rotate.

  • Check that the bottom of power pod is clean and no ingredients are blocking connection when attaching the splash guard.

  • There are too many ingredients in the jar.

  • The unit has overheated or overloaded. Unplug and wait approximately 10 minutes
    before using again.

  • Make sure the splash guard lid is securely attached to jar.

  • Make sure the power pod is securely seated on splash guard lid.

  • Check that the plug is securely inserted into the electrical outlet.

  • Check fuse or breaker in your home. Replace fuse/reset breaker.

Ingredients are unevenly chopped.
• Either you are chopping too many ingredients at one time,
or the pieces are not small enough. Try cutting the ingredients into smaller pieces of even
size and processing smaller amounts per batch.

Ingredients are chopped too fine or are too watery.
• The ingredients have been over-processed. Use brief pulses or process for a shorter time.
Let blade assembly stop completely between pulses.

Ingredients collect on splash guard lid or on the sides of the jar.
• You may be processing too many ingredients. Turn the unit off. When the blade assembly
comes to a complete stop, take off the power pod and splash guard lid, and remove
some of the ingredients

You cannot create snow from solid ice.
• Do not use ice that has been sitting out or has started to melt. Use ice straight from the
freezer. Start by using short pulses to break up large pieces, then continue processing
until snow is achieved.
